The cheapest way to get from O'Connell Street to Ennis (Station) is to bus which costs €22 - €30 and takes 3h 45m.
The fastest way to get from O'Connell Street to Ennis (Station) is to drive which takes 2h 35m and costs €35 - €55.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Burgh Quay and arriving at Ennis Frs Walk. Services depart hourly,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 3h 30m.
No, there is no direct train from O'Connell Street to Ennis (Station). However, there are services departing from Abbey St. and arriving at Ennis via Dublin Heuston, Limerick Junction and Limerick.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 18m.
The distance between O'Connell Street and Ennis (Station) is 239 km. The road distance is 221.8 km.
The best way to get from O'Connell Street to Ennis (Station) without a car is to bus which takes 3h 45m and costs €22 - €30.
The bus from Burgh Quay to Ennis Frs Walk takes 3h 30m including transfers and departs hourly.
O'Connell Street to Ennis (Station) bus services, operated by Dublin Coach, depart from Burgh Quay station.
O'Connell Street to Ennis (Station) train services, operated by Iarnród Éireann (Irish Rail), depart from Dublin Heuston station.
The best way to get from O'Connell Street to Ennis (Station) is to bus which takes 3h 45m and costs €22 - €30. Alternatively, you can train, which costs €24 - €40 and takes 4h 18m, you could also fly, which costs €70 - €260 and takes 6h 5m.
